			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p>The best car seats for you and your baby are the ones that fit your lifestyle and budget. All car seats sold in the US have passed crash tests for safety. How safe a car seat is for your child depends on a few factors, such as the size, height and weight of your child. Also there are difference between a rear facing seat and a forward facing seat. The rear facing seats are considered safer, but can only be used up to a maximum height/weight depending on manufacturing specifications. Finding the best car seats can be simple once you decide which category your child falls in.</p>
<p>There are the baby seats or infant carriers that are rear facing and can hold newborn babies from 5lbs to 22lbs, and heights up to 29 inches. The best car seats have a 5-point harness system, which is considered safer than an overhead shield. Some infant car seats have bases to allow easy access. They should be set at no more than 45 degrees to provide head and neck support. Once you find the best car seats make sure you do not place them in a seat containing airbags. Your child must remain in a rear-facing seat until he is over 20lbs and over a year old. If your child is over the weight limit before he is 1 year old, you should place him in a larger rear-facing seat.</p>
<p>Convertible car seat are often considered the best car seats by being the most economical, because they can last many years by converting into a forward facing and even turning into a booster seat as your child grows. They usually hold your child rear facing up to 35lbs and some manufactures go higher. There typically is a large selection of convertible seats to match your style preferences. But again for safety the best car seats are left rear facing until the child outgrows the weight limit or the top of is his head is with in an inch of the top of the car seat.</p>
<p>After your child out grows his rear-facing seat they need to move up to a booster seat. Because seat belts were made to safely restrain adults a booster seat is needed to boost your child to the appropriate height where the seat belt is properly positioned. There are two types of boosters a high back and no back. Studies have shown the best car seat boosters are the ones with the high backs because they offer better protection in side impact. The time when a child is ready to sit without a booster is not age or weight specific but more when he can sit in the seat and the seat belt fits properly. This is all depends on the size of the child and the design of the vehicle.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p>Letting grandma care for my baby for an overnight visit was intended to provide me rest. I had never been away from my daughter for any length of time in her short four month old lifetime. For over a month, my mother had been asking to keep her for an overnight visit, and I could not put it off any longer. Preparing everything to get her to grandma&#8217;s house made me feel like I needed a vacation. And I had never been apart from my baby overnight. My mom bought a few baby things to keep at her house, but she does not have everything she needed even for an overnight visit. My mind started going over the possibilities. If she needed to go anywhere, the baby travel system with the car seat and the seat base was a necessity. I would have to install it in her car before we left.</p>
<p>It is important to be prepared, and even though I knew my mother wasn&#8217;t planning on going anywhere, I wanted her to be able to go if necessary. So to be prepared for anything, the stroller, car seat and base went into my van. Although my mother did have a play pen which could be used as an overnight crib, my daughter seldom falls asleep in her crib. I usually have to put her in one of my ring slings and wear her around the house until she falls asleep. After she has fallen asleep, I carefully place her in her crib. I brought along one of my ring slings and planned on showing my mother how to use it. My husband and I decided to use cloth diapers during the pregnancy. Cloth diapers were used with my older siblings but I was a disposable diaper baby. She likened my cloth diaper decision to going in reverse. my mother had a hard time understanding how much cloth diapers had improved since her days of diapering me. To show her how simple they were to use, I was going to bring along my Fuzzi Bunz cloth diapers. I packed the cloth diapers as well as a wet bag so that I could show my mother how much they had improved from the old style cloth diaper. I needed a rest when I finally completed packing the vehicle, but I had to leave. My mother and I spent over two hours going over everything after heading to her home. When she asked me if I thought she had ever taken care of a baby, I realized it was time to leave.</p>
<p>Everything that would make the overnight visit easy for both my mother and daughter was packed. I then went back home to prepare for my dinner date with my husband. I could not enjoy my evening out because I missed my baby so much I ended up calling my mother almost ten times in three hours. The visit went very well and all my worry was for naught. My mother had a wonderful time taking care of a little one once again while my daughter slept through the entire night for the first time.</p>
